There are a couple of new search engines to briefly report about today. The first is Zumber, based out of Australia. Zumber was created in early 2006 and is still in beta. The default interface is clean and simple, and there’s a nifty style selector that lets you create your own look. Zumber also offers pay-per-click advertising, and has a keyword directory that lists the most commonly used search terms. This is great for both searchers and marketers.
GenieKnows local search is the other new engine, also still in beta. This one works by entering a string of phrases into the search bar, including the city or location you’re trying to search. For example, “Starbucks in Seattle†returns a list of Starbucks locations including a map of where they’re located. The problem is, it currently only works for US locations. The SERP is divided into sponsored listings, business results and web results.
